Output 18f609659ae70e517442dbde481496a28a27b87b5c8a8395fad15d2015aeb860:37

value
281979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ed44517a88f35e6a372251dbb91040048b73bae OP_EQUAL
address
3DFdMV61MtLdEMPXq6G3hJD84RCMWdLdkK
transaction
18f609659ae70e517442dbde481496a28a27b87b5c8a8395fad15d2015aeb860
spent
true